Clinton also wants to staple Green Cards to degrees of foreign STEM graduates.
While she may have not said much on the H-1B visa on the campaign trail so far, in materials leaked by WikiLeaks, the Democratic nominee for President Hillary Clinton has expressed her staunch support for the work visa program, which allows American companies to hire foreign workers annually.
Clinton repeatedly touted the H-1B visa program while meeting behind closed doors with technology companies, Wall Street firms and banks during 2013 and 2014, according to a collection of her comments released by unknown hackers.
“The only point I would make for the tech community is on the H1B visas, I support them. When I was a Senator from New York I supported them,” she told a meeting hosted by a software company in August 2014, according to a document apparently prepared by her campaign team, and reported by Breitbart News.
“So let me just make three quick points,” Clinton said in April 2014, at a summit hosted by a marketing company. “One, I think it’s essential to keep focused on the [H-1B] visa issue, because that’s a discrete problem that even though I’d like to see it be part of an overall, comprehensive reform, you have to keep pushing to open the aperture, you know, get more and more opportunities.”
In June, 2013, Clinton told an event for a personnel-management trade association that she agreed with their call for government to expand the H-1B visa program to start providing work-permits to all foreigners who graduate from U.S. colleges with masters’ degrees.
Clinton declared: “…Specifically about H-1B visas, you know, we give so many more student visas than we give H-1B visas … I support what you’re trying to do because I think our economic recovery is to some extent fueled by a steady stream of well-qualified, productive workers coming out of our own institutions, native born, legally here and those who have something to contribute who are going to help us continue to grow our economy.
On the 2016 campaign trail, Clinton’s campaign has repeated that offer to “staple Green Cards” to foreigners’ college degrees.
In 2013, Clinton supported a similar provision that was included in the Senate’s “Comprehensive Immigration Reform bill, but the measure was eventually killed by GOP grassroots opposition in June 2014.
At an event where she praised the H-1B visa program and the 2013 comprehensive immigration bill, Clinton also suggested that companies try to show some “sensitivity” towards American job-seekers.
“But given the great recession and the fact that so many people lost jobs across the economy including in the tech field, there has to be an extra effort made to try to fill jobs with people who are already here. They can be either native born or immigrants, but already here, so that then if that’s not possible you have a good faith argument that you tried, because too many people [think] the H1B visas are, instead of an opportunity to get good, strong talent, a way of avoiding hiring American workers. So I do think there has to be some sensitivity to that, but I believe that’s doable. I don’t think that’s an overwhelming task.”
